技术文摘
在 Navicat 中如何让转储的 SQL 文件包含创建数据库语句
2025-01-14 17:33:22 小编
在数据库管理工作中,使用Navicat转储SQL文件时,让其包含创建数据库语句能带来诸多便利,比如方便在新环境中快速部署完整的数据库结构。那么,在Navicat中如何实现这一需求呢?
打开Navicat软件并连接到你需要操作的数据库。连接成功后,在左侧的“导航器”中找到对应的数据库。
接着,右键点击该数据库,在弹出的菜单中选择“转储SQL文件”选项,这里有两个子选项,分别是“结构和数据”以及“仅结构”。如果希望转储的SQL文件不仅包含数据库的结构,还包含其中的数据,就选择“结构和数据”;若只需要数据库的结构信息,选择“仅结构”即可。
在弹出的“转储SQL文件”对话框中,有多个设置选项。重点关注“常规”选项卡,在这里有“包含”部分。找到“创建数据库语句”这一选项,将其勾选上。这一步至关重要,决定了最终转储的SQL文件中是否会包含创建数据库的语句。
还可以对其他选项进行设置。例如,在“文件”部分可以指定转储文件的保存路径和文件名;在“格式”部分能设置SQL语句的格式,如缩进、换行等,以提高生成文件的可读性。
设置完成后,点击“开始”按钮,Navicat就会按照你的设置开始转储SQL文件。转储过程可能需要一些时间,具体取决于数据库的大小和复杂程度。
当转储完成后,打开生成的SQL文件,你会发现文件开头包含了创建数据库的语句。这样,在新的服务器环境中,只需运行这个SQL文件,就能自动创建数据库以及相应的表结构和数据(如果选择了“结构和数据”)。
掌握在Navicat中让转储的SQL文件包含创建数据库语句的方法,能够大大提高数据库迁移和部署的效率,减少手动操作可能出现的错误,为数据库管理工作带来极大的便利。
- 微软开源的 Python 自动化利器 Playwright
- 2020 年 Python 生态圈的年度总结之 top10 类库
- 深鸿会深大小组:鸿蒙 Hi3861 环境搭建详解
- 漫谈前端组件化
- Java 编码方式知多少?解决乱码并非难事
- 深入解读 Django ORM 操作(进阶版)
- SVG 元素:一篇文章带你全知晓
- 苹果 VR 手套专利披露:由智能织物与 IMU 构成,可测手指运动
- 苹果获近红外光学 AR/VR 眼球追踪技术专利授权
- C 语言在当今编程领域的地位之正确认知
- 2021 年码农免费的 Python 机器学习课程
- 实时 VR 系统对慢性疼痛疗法疗效的显著提升研究
- 5 种让 Python 代码加速的神奇之法
- 通过简单游戏学习 Python 编写
- 程序员抢茅台脚本两天刷榜 GitHub 后谢幕